It likes slightly acidic … WebAquarium Floating Plants for Beginners (Levitating Plants) - Jan 28 2024 The top of the water and the surface above it is the best place for light and gas exchange. Most plants, even when rooted in the substrate, try to send their leaves and stem close to the surface to take advantage of this prime aquatic real estate.

Since these plants float along the surface they influence the amount of light that enters the water. If you have a species of fish that’s used to shady waters, a floating plant can make them feel right at home. Not only will this keep them comfortably physically, but it will also reduce their stress levels as well.
